The Exchange Club/Holland J. Stephens Center for the Prevention of Child Abuse is a non-profit 501(c)3 agency established in 1988 and now serving Putnam, Cumberland, Overton, White, DeKalb, and Macon Counties. Licensed by the TN Dept. of Children’s services as a child abuse prevention agency, the mission is to identify families with children (prenatal through age 12) at-risk of child abuse and neglect and to prevent the abuse/neglect through appropriate in-home visitation, group parenting, or community education program. The agency’s goals/outcomes for the year include: 85% (43 of 50) families in the Healthier Beginnings program and 85% (48 of 56) in the Healthy Start program will demonstrate that family stress has been reduced and family functioning has been improved as measured by the Kempe Family Stress/Parent Survey. 85% (34 of 40) families in the Parent-Child Connection group parenting program will demonstrate a decreased risk for child abuse and neglect as demonstrated by the Adult Adolescent Parenting Inventor.
